Ingredients

  • 1 12(ounce) 1 steamer bag Cauliflower

  • 1 large 1 egg

  • 1/2 cup 1/2 shredded mozzarella cheese

  • 1 medoum 1 ripe avocado

  • 1/2 tsp 1/2 garlic powder

  • 1/4 tsp 1/4 ground black pepper

Directions

  • Cook cauliflower according to package instructions. Remove from bag and place into cheesecloth or clean towel to remove excess moisture.
  • Place cauliflower into a large bowl and mix in egg and mozzarella.
  • Cut a piece of parchment to fit your air fryer basket.
  • Separate the cauliflower mixture into two, and place it on the parchment in two mounds.
  • Press out the cauliflower mounds into a 1/4″-thick rectangle.
  • Place the parchment into the air fryer basket.
  • Adjust the temperature to 400°F and set the timer for 8 minutes.
  • Flip the cauliflower halfway through the cooking time.
  • When the timer beeps, remove the parchment and allow the cauliflower to cool 5 minutes.
  • Cut open the avocado and remove the pit. Scoop out the inside, place it in a medium bowl, and mash it with garlic powder and pepper.
  • Spread onto the cauliflower.
  • Serve immediately.
